问答详情
源自:1-2 编程练习

不知道哪里错了啊 !点击按钮没有弹出对话框, 有大神帮我看下吗?

<!DOCTYPE HTML>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
<title>系好安全带,准备启航</title>
<!--引入外部文件的方式-->

<script type="text/javascript">
//多行注释
  /*我是多行注释!
  我需要隐藏,
  否则会报错哦!*/

//在页面中显示文字
document.write("系好安全带,准备启航--目标JS""<br>")

//页面中弹出提示框
function dianji(){
    var tanchu=confirm("点击我,准备好了吗?");
    if(tanchu==true){
        document.write("准备好了!");
    }
    else{
        document.write("没准备好!");
    }
}

//单行注释
   //我是单行注释,我也要隐藏起来!

</script>
</head>
<body>
<input type="button" onclik="dianji()" value="准备好了,起航吧">
</body>
</html>

提问者:爱的色放 2016-05-19 16:06

个回答

  • 嘎尜嘎
    2016-05-19 16:33:42
    已采纳

    onclick单词错误   document.write("系好安全带,准备启航--目标JS""<br>")少了分号  document.write("系好安全带,准备启航--目标JS"+"<br>");或者document.write("系好安全带,准备启航--目标JS<br>");

  • 慕移动9181930
    2022-03-27 10:55:30

    constendTime=newDate(2014,6,18,18,47,52);截止时间,6=7月,从0开始编号【time:2014-07-1818:47:52】

  • 左阙
    2016-05-19 16:58:42

    document.write("系好安全带,准备启航--目标JS""<br>")应改为

    document.write("系好安全带,准备启航--目标JS"+"<br>")

    另外<input type="button" onclik="dianji()" value="准备好了,起航吧">应改为

    <input type="button" onclick="dianji()" value="准备好了,起航吧">

  • 努力攻城的小狮子
    2016-05-19 16:22:08

    onclick="dianji()"

  • hhimooc
    2016-05-19 16:16:29

    不是叫你引入外部文件吗? 把js的内容复制到js文件中

  • qq_静默_6
    2016-05-19 16:16:08

    <input>标签里的onclick属性单词写错了。

  • A_杰娃
    2016-05-19 16:15:38

    document.write("系好安全带,准备启航--目标JS""<br>")这一句你确定这么写?